Ultrafast dynamics in waveguide saturable absorbers
Summary form only given. The results of a model of differential transmission measurements in GaAs-GaAlAs waveguide saturable absorbers indicate that high field effects, spectral hole burning and carrier heating are important mechanisms governing absorption dynamics.
